WHAT YOU’LL DO
the company is a fast-paced, growth-oriented company and in order to sustain this peak performance, it’s important that our go-to-market teams are highly productive. As a Sr. GTM Enablement Manager, you will report to the Sr. Director of Sales Enablement and your role is to provide our GTM teams in the region with the tools, skills and knowledge to be successful. This role serves as the connective tissue between the company's global enablement centre of excellence and APAC's local sales execution, translating global programs into locally relevant, consistently reinforced enablement that drives measurable impact on the ground.
Regional Enablement
- Partner with Regional Sales leadership to identify priorities, diagnose business needs, and build enablement programs with deep shared ownership, ensuring adoption at a grassroots level.
- Design and maintain a programmatic, recurring skills curriculum across core sales excellence themes including value-based selling, objection handling, competitive differentiation, negotiation, and outreach ensuring consistent upskilling cadence across APAC teams.
- Localise and reinforce global competitive intelligence and differentiation frameworks, partnering with regional sales leaders to identify emerging threats and equip teams with market-ready defensive playbooks and narratives.
- Establish a consistent operating rhythm with Sales leaders, providing regular updates, surfacing needs, and reinforcing accountability for program adoption.
- Drive regional execution of enablement programs,
ensuring rollout is timely, tracked, and supported through explicit communication.
- Monitor and report on adoption and performance metrics, closing the loop with leadership to highlight progress and gaps.
Global Enablement
- Act as the regional voice to the GTM Enablement & Productivity team, providing insights and feedback to shape global programs.
- Ensure consistent rollout of global initiatives in-region, adapting only where needed for local effectiveness.
- Share adoption data, feedback, and best practices back to global teams to inform program design and scaling.
- Where appropriate, lead global enablement initiatives, alongside regional responsibilities.
